Does Riverse conduct public consultation?

Yes, the Riverse Standard includes public consultation as part of the process for methodology creation and revisions. The Secretariat organizes a 30-day public consultation by publishing a "Call for Consultation," allowing stakeholders, industry experts, and the general public to provide insights and feedback. This feedback is then integrated into a Final Methodology Creation Proposition, which is validated by the Standard Advisory Board.

Public consultations are conducted at three levels:

  • For every main Standard documents release
  • For each new methodology and methodology major update
  • For each project during the certification process.
